BACKGROUND & AIMS: The second-generation Pillcam Colon Capsule Endoscope (PCCE-2; Given Imaging Ltd, Yoqneam, Israel) is an ingestible capsule for visualization of the colon. We performed a multicenter pilot study to assess its safety and feasibility in evaluating the severity of Crohn's disease (CD). METHODS: In a prospective study, 40 patients with active colonic CD underwent PCCE-2 and optical colonoscopy procedures. Using both techniques, we generated values for the Crohn's Disease Endoscopic Index of Severity (CDEIS), the Simple Endoscopic Score for CD, and global evaluation of lesion severity. In the first stage of the study, we calculated the correlation between PCCE-2 and optical colonoscopy scores. In the second stage, we performed interobserver agreement analysis for a random subset of 20 PCCE-2 recordings, graded in duplicate by 2 independent readers. RESULTS: There was substantial agreement between PCCE-2 and optical colonoscopy in the measurement of the CDEIS (intraclass correlation coefficient [ICC], 0.65; 95% confidence interval [CI], 0.43-0.80). There was substantial interobserver agreement between 2 independent PCCE-2 readers for the CDEIS (ICC, 0.67; 95% CI, 0.35-0.86) and the Simple Endoscopic Score for CD (ICC, 0.66; 95% CI, 0.32-0.85). However, the PCCE-2 scoring systematically underestimated the severity of disease compared with optical colonoscopy; based on our results, PCCE-2 detected colonic ulcerations with 86% sensitivity and 40% specificity. No adverse events were observed and PCCE-2 was better tolerated than colonoscopy. CONCLUSIONS: PCCE-2 is feasible, safe, and well tolerated for the assessment of mucosal CD activity in selected populations. Larger studies are needed to assess its operating characteristics further. BACKGROUND: Continuous glucose monitoring (CGM) has been shown to improve glucose control in adults with type 1 diabetes. Effectiveness of CGM is directly linked with CGM adherence, which can be challenging to maintain in children and adolescents. We hypothesize that initiating CGM at the same time as starting insulin pump therapy in pump naïve children and adolescents with type 1 diabetes will result in greater CGM adherence and effectiveness compared to delaying CGM introduction by 6 months, and that this is related to greater readiness for making behaviour change at the time of pump initiation. METHODS/DESIGN: The CGM TIME Trial is a multicenter randomized controlled trial. Eligible children and adolescents (5-18 years) with established type 1 diabetes were randomized to simultaneous initiation of pump (Medtronic Veo©) and CGM (Enlite©) or to standard pump therapy with delayed CGM introduction. Primary outcomes are CGM adherence and hemoglobin A1C at 6 and 12 months post pump initiation. Secondary outcomes include glycemic variability, stage of readiness, and other patient-reported outcomes with follow-up to 24 months. 144 (95%) of the 152 eligible patients were enrolled and randomized. Allowing for 10% withdrawals, this will provide 93% power to detect a between group difference in CGM adherence and 86% power to detect a between group difference in hemoglobin A1C. Baseline characteristics were similar between the treatment groups. Analysis of 12 month primary outcomes will begin in September 2014. DISCUSSION: The CGM TIME Trial is the first study to examine the relationship between timing of CGM initiation, readiness for behaviour change, and subsequent CGM adherence in pump naïve children and adolescents. Its findings will advance our understanding of when and how to initiate CGM in children and adolescents with type 1 diabetes. TRIAL REGISTRATION: ClinicalTrial.gov NCT01295788. INTRODUCTION: The objectives of this study were to determine the economic, clinical, and quality-of-life outcomes associated with olanzapine treatment in patients diagnosed with mania. METHODS: Patients with a diagnosis of bipolar I disorder with manic or mixed episodes were enrolled in a randomized controlled trial. The study design comprised a 3-week acute phase followed by a 49-week open label extension. In the open label extension, the use of lithium and fluoxetine was permitted for patients who experienced breakthrough symptoms. Clinical, economic, and quality-of-life outcomes of treatment were assessed. RESULTS: During the acute phase, olanzapine patients experienced a statistically significant greater mean improvement from baseline on the Y-MRS total score compared to the placebo patients. In the open label extension, patients experienced a statistically significant mean change of 11.8 units on the Y-MRS from the end of the acute phase. When compared to costs incurred in the previous 12 months of therapy, patients experienced savings of almost $900 per month during the 49 weeks of olanzapine therapy. These cost savings were largely driven by reductions in in-patient costs during the open label extension. Health-related quality of life improvements measured by the SF-36 were seen on several dimensions both in the 3-week acute phase as well as in the 49-week open label extension. CONCLUSION: From a clinical, economic, and quality-of-life outcomes standpoint, olanzapine had a significant impact in the treatment of mania, and could be considered a cost-effective treatment option for use in this population if these findings are extrapolated to non-clinical trial populations.
